Understanding Payroll Data Organisation

Payroll data includes employee information, salary details, tax deductions, bonuses, and benefits. Managing this information manually can become overwhelming, especially as a business grows. Disorganised payroll records can lead to calculation mistakes, compliance issues, and employee dissatisfaction.

Digital payroll systems solve these challenges by storing data in structured formats. They allow quick access, easy updates, and accurate calculations. When businesses adopt digital tools, they gain better control over their payroll process.

Steps to Organise Payroll Data Digitally

Implementing a digital payroll organisation requires a structured approach. Follow these steps to build an efficient system:

1. Centralise Payroll Information

Start by gathering all payroll-related data in one place. This includes employee details, salary structures, tax information, and attendance records. Digital platforms allow you to store everything in a single dashboard.

3. Maintain Employee Profiles

Create detailed digital profiles for each employee. These profiles should include:

  • Personal information
  • Job role and salary
  • Tax details
  • Benefits and deductions

Best Practices for Payroll Data Management

To maximise the benefits of digital payroll solutions, follow these best practices:

Keep Data Organised
Use clear categories and labels for payroll records. This improves accessibility and reduces confusion.

Limit Access
Only authorised personnel should access payroll data. Digital tools allow role-based permissions to enhance security.

Stay Compliant
